Host Andy Samberg took on race and gender issues in Hollywood during his Emmys opening monologue. After pointing out that this year’s awards are the most diverse Emmys ever, the host quipped, “Racism is over! Don’t fact-check that.”
He also joked about sexism on TV. “The wage gap between men and women hired for major roles in Hollywood is still an issue,” he said of the continuing divide between male and female actors. “Wait. I misread that. The age gap between men and women hired for major roles in Hollywood is still an issue.” He paused. “I misread that again. It’s both.”
